Transaction 59fa04f04d2a3ddc211014cef7c809769c18e2a2f9e2256e3c9c5345f22e610a

1 Input
2 Outputs
  • 59fa04f04d2a3ddc211014cef7c809769c18e2a2f9e2256e3c9c5345f22e610a:0
  • value  32000000
    address  14CFLrsVR1ASRW34VXBPCeYLPZQrakXuak
  • 59fa04f04d2a3ddc211014cef7c809769c18e2a2f9e2256e3c9c5345f22e610a:1
  • value  435030000
    address  1PuVfNSZmTVMXxcZ1AA6EGMuGHVZGKEo85